We are pleased to share with you a new vision for Caritas Health Group, approved by the Caritas Board of Directors following extensive consultation with almost 900 internal and external stakeholders earlier this year.
From March to June 2007, Caritas held 42 consultation sessions to obtain input into the vision and strategic themes and the future direction of our organization, which operates the Grey Nuns and Misericordia Community Hospitals and the Edmonton General Continuing Care Centre. Almost 600 Caritas physicians, staff and volunteers provided their advice and perspectives through in-person sessions and an on-line survey. In addition, we personally met with almost 300 community leaders, partners and supporters—representing 100 local organizations, agencies and groups. |
Building on the rich discussion and thoughtful contributions of our team and the community we serve, the Board of Directors also approved four strategic directions to guide our efforts to achieve this vision. This Fall we will finalize a number of strategic initiatives as part of our strategic planning process and will continue to engage key stakeholders as these are developed and implemented.
Vision 2020
Caritas Health Group will become Canada's leading faith-based provider of health care by positively influencing the health of the community through compassionate care for all and innovative service to those in greatest need.
Strategic Directions
Building and Supporting the Team Create a fulfilling workplace that attracts sufficient, skilled, engaged and committed team members.
Developing Strategic Partnerships and Engaging Community Seek out and work with others as leader, catalyst, supporter and partner in improving the lives of individuals and their community.
Leading in Quality and Service Ensure quality and be of greater service to the community and Capital Health in meeting growing demands and unmet needs.
Living and Sharing Our Mission Ignite and nurture a sense of calling and commitment to the Mission in every member of the team and set the standards for compassionate care.
